Massachusetts 2025-2026 Regular Session

Massachusetts House Bill H4007

Introduced
4/7/25  

Caption

Relative to the composition of the licensing board for the city of Salem

Summary

House Bill H4007 proposes changes to the composition of the licensing board specifically for the city of Salem, Massachusetts. The bill aims to streamline the functioning of this board by reducing its size to three regular members and one alternate member. The appointments will be made by the mayor and must be confirmed by the city council, approved municipal governance structure. The terms for the members are defined to ensure continuity with a three-year duration for regular members and a one-year term for the initial alternate member.
